
Stephen Gordin grew up in rural South Carolina, and folk and country music of the mid- 1960's served as an early musical influence. He was also intrigued by the big band sounds and the crooners of his parents' generation.. He began writing music later in life, when he felt he had developed enough life experiences to tell his stories. However, once he did, he has been prolific, primarily writing in a folk/blues/country style. However, he has also ventured into Southern rock, beach music, and alternative rock.
